According to a report from www.nw.de,
A summary of the article shows that various properties in the Minden-Lübbecke district are up for foreclosure. These include houses, undeveloped land and a residential/commercial building on land used for agriculture and forestry.
Foreclosures can have various effects on the regional real estate market. On the one hand, they offer buyers the opportunity to get properties cheaply, but on the other hand, they can also influence prices on the market. Especially if several properties are up for auction at the same time, this can lead to an oversupply and thus to price pressure.
Additionally, the increasing number of foreclosures may indicate possible economic uncertainties that could impact the real estate industry as a whole.
It is important that potential buyers become well informed before a foreclosure auction and consider the risks and opportunities associated with it. They should also carefully examine the legal framework in order to gain clarity about their rights and obligations.
It remains to be seen how developments on the real estate market in the Minden-Lübbecke district will develop in the coming months and whether rising interest rates will actually lead to an increase in foreclosures.
